i am testing the waters on selling my 1997 993 targa. I have enjoyed it so much that i am looking to upgrade to a 993 C2S or C4S. if it does not sell, i will just keep driving it and enjoying it.


**i want to be frank and upfront that it has a rebuilt title due to a house fire in 2010.** high heat and smoke damaged the exterior paint. the car itself did not catch fire. the actual body panels, engine/mechanics/electrical, and interior were not damaged. if that bothers you, please move on from this thread. i understand the title situation makes it tricky to price and sell. i would prefer that this thread not deteriorate into a pricing debate or rebuilt title debate. thanks in advance.


i purchased the car in june 2017 from a local 25 year PCA member who had owned the car for 7 years prior to that. he purchased the car from california after the car was involved in a house fire. you can see a thread i started last summer after i bought the car detailing the rebuilt title, purchase, and updates:

https://rennlist.com/forums/993-foru...997-targa.html

the previous owner resprayed the car in its factory black color in 2010, and its a pretty good paint job. there are only a few minor scratches. no dents/dings. the paint shows extremely well, and i get more compliments on this car than any of my other porsches. the interior is near perfect with the exception of a few cracks in the dash. the targa mechanism works great. all electronics work as well. i have all records since i have owned the car. the previous owner was a mechanic on the side and did all of his own maintenance. i have none of his records or records prior to his ownership.

the mileage on the car is 67,094 which is believed to be correct. i have logged approximately 1,500 miles on the car in the past 9 months that i have owned it. the engine starts right up and idles smooth. it pulls hard through the gears. no leaks whatsoever. transmission shifts well. the car drives and handles very well. i have debated lowering the car slightly and redoing the suspension due to the car's age, but given how well it drives, i have chosen not to pursue this at this point. i did have the front upper strut mounts replaced recently.

since i have owned the car, the following maintenance/modifications have been done:
-new front/rear brake rotors, sensors, and pads (within last 100 miles)
-two oil changes (most recent within last 100 miles)
-new air filter
-new front upper strut mount replacement
-alignment
-new tires and completely refurbished/repainted OEM 2 piece speedline wheels (less than 1k miles)
-replaced air bag suspension ring
-replaced timing cover gaskets
-new steering rack and pinion
-replaced transmission shaft seal and new transmission fluid
-AC charged, cabin air filters replaced, new drive belt
-new alternator belt and new fan belt
-new battery
-fister stage 2 exhaust in matte black
-new fabspeed exhaust tips
-new front and rear lloyd floor mats
-new alpine head unit with bluetooth and USB outlet (i do not have the OEM head unit)
-new focal front speakers
-new rear polk speakers
-new rear stone guards
-new side stripes
-new instrument trim rings

overall, this is a solid well sorted car that looks fantastic and drives great despite having a rebuilt title. it would make someone a great 993 that can be daily driven and used in the real world without fear of adding miles or getting a scratch on it. i would not hesitate to take the car on a long distance drive, and will likely drive it to rennsport reunion this year if it has not sold. if anyone has any questions, feel free to PM me. thanks for looking.
